Managing Issues of Water Filling Up
The typical source of water loading problems in washing makers is commonly connected to a breakdown in the water inlet valve or the pressure switch. The shutoff controls the water circulation right into the device, and the pressure button signals when the desired water level is gotten to. When the valve is damaged or the pressure switch is not functioning appropriately, it can cause incorrect water levels, creating either too much or inadequate water to fill the machine.

One technique of troubleshooting includes manually filling the device with water. If the equipment operates normally when manually loaded, the problem likely lies within the water inlet shutoff. Additionally, if an excessive quantity of water gets in the equipment despite getting to the established level, the stress switch is likely the wrongdoer. It is essential for homeowners to adhere to the specific guidelines and safety precautions supplied by the supplier when evaluating these elements, or take into consideration enlisting the support of an expert.

Dealing With Drainage Issues
When a laundry equipment experiences drain issues, one common sign is water lingering inside the device even after a clean cycle finishes. This problem can be brought on by different variables such as a blocked or kinked drain hose, or a malfunctioning drain pump. Understanding these normal reasons is important for recognizing and settling the underlying problem effectively. If water remains to accumulate in spite of several rinse attempts, it is vital to act quickly to avoid water damages or the development of mold.

Carrying out a systematic technique to attend to drain interruptions can create successful outcomes. Starting with a visual examination of the drain hose pipe can help identify potential blockages or physical damages. If straightening out a curved hose pipe or removing a blockage does not resolve the issue, it might be needed to think about a malfunctioning drain pump, which might need expert repair or substitute. Furthermore, thoroughly observing any mistake codes shown on the appliance's console throughout the cycle can provide valuable details regarding the root cause of the disturbance. Consulting the home appliance manual can help decipher these mistake messages, even more aiding in determining the exact problem.

Fixing Non-Spinning Issues
Among the typical issues you may face with your washing device is a non-spinning drum. This is normally a signs and symptom of a mechanical failing, normally with the motor, belts, or lid button. The electric motor is what powers your washing machine's spin cycle, and if it's burnt out or defective, your washing machine won't spin. Similarly, malfunctioning belts and lid switches can prevent the drum's capability to turn.

Determining the origin of a non-spinning problem can be a challenging job, but it's an essential step in fixing the problem successfully. To start, evaluate the lid button for any indications of damage or wear. You can swiftly confirm if the lid button is the offender by paying attention for a distinct clicking audio when opening and closing the cover. If the sound is missing, replacing the lid switch might be essential. Sometimes, busted belts or burnt out electric motors may need an extra thorough examination by a professional. Bear in mind, security must constantly be your top concern when collaborating with electrical or mechanical elements, so see to it the washer is unplugged before checking any kind of parts.

Managing Washing Cycle Disruptions
Laundry appliance problems can extend past plain water filling up or draining pipes troubles. Incomplete cycles, where the equipment quits suddenly throughout clean, rinse, or rotate cycles, can be especially vexing. This issue can stem from numerous resources, including defective timers or control panel, malfunctioning cover switches, overheating motors, or damaged water level buttons. Dealing with these underlying causes is vital to bring back the home appliance's normal cycle.

Resolving this issue requires a mindful diagnostic process to identify the root of the concern. Begin by conducting a straightforward assessment of the lid button, as deterioration over time can trigger it to stop operating correctly. Moving along, inspect the water level button; if it is defective, it might send inaccurate signals to the machine concerning when to begin and stop. You might also intend to check the appliance's control panel and timer. If they are malfunctioning, the equipment might either quit mid-cycle or not begin at all. Please keep in mind that this sort of fixing should be accomplished with care as electrical power is involved, and if you are unclear regarding any action of the process, it is advised you seek advice from a qualified specialist.

Managing Excessive Sound and Vibration Problems
If your laundry device is creating way too much noise and vibration, it could be a sign of different issues such as an unbalanced tons or a malfunctioning component in the device. Resonances usually take place when clothes are not evenly spread out in the drum, but this can be fixed by stopping the cycle and rearranging the load. However, if the noise and vibration continue, it may be brought on by worn-out or loosened drive belts, drum bearings, or electric motor parts.

To detect properly, an individual may require to manually inspect the discussed parts for any signs of wear or damage and change any kind of defective aspects immediately. If your home appliance is constantly making loud noises, in spite of your attempts at load redistribution, it's strongly advised to get in touch with a specialist. A certified service technician will have the skills and expertise to recognize and remedy the root of the problem, guaranteeing your maker operates smoothly and silently. It's vital to attend to these problems promptly, as long term resonances or noises might create additional damage to your device or environments.
